Key Features
• Stable 4.95V/5V Reference Voltage Trimmed to ±1.0% Accuracy
• Uncommitted Output TR for 200mA Sink or Source Current
• Single-End or Push-Pull Operation Selected by Output Control
• Internal Circuitry Prohibits Double Pulse at Either Output
• Complete PWM Control Circuit with Variable Duty Cycle
• On-Chip Oscillator with Master or Slave Operation

The AZ494A/C is a voltage mode pulse width modulation switching regulator control circuit designed primarily for power supply control. The AZ494A/C consists of a reference voltage circuit, two error amplifiers, an on-chip adjustable oscillator, a dead-time control (DTC) comparator, a pulse-steering control flip-flop, and an output control circuit. The precision of voltage reference (VREF) is improved up to ± 1% through trimming and this provides a better output voltage regulation. The AZ494A/C provides for pushpull or single-ended output operation, which can be selected through the output control. The difference between AZ494A and AZ494C is that they have 4.95V and 5V reference voltage respectively.
